Skip to content

Commit 6db2eda

Browse files
committed
format
1 parent 2d0df2b commit 6db2eda

File tree

1 file changed

+20
-3
lines changed

1 file changed

+20
-3
lines changed

lib/ex_webrtc_recorder.ex

Lines changed: 20 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-305,7 +305,14 @@ defmodule ExWebRTC.Recorder do
305305

306306
state = %{state | track_data: Map.merge(state.track_data, new_track_data)}
307307

308-
:ok = File.write!(state.manifest_path, state.track_data |> to_manifest() |> ExWebRTC.Recorder.Manifest.to_map() |> Jason.encode!())
308+
:ok =
309+
File.write!(
310+
state.manifest_path,
311+
state.track_data
312+
|> to_manifest()
313+
|> ExWebRTC.Recorder.Manifest.to_map()
314+
|> Jason.encode!()
315+
)
309316

310317
{manifest_diff, state}
311318
end
@@ -347,9 +354,19 @@ defmodule ExWebRTC.Recorder do
347354

348355
defp update_codec(state, track_id, codec) do
349356
case get_in(state, [:track_data, track_id, :codec]) do
350-
updated_track_data = put_in(state.track_data , [track_id, :codec], codec)
357+
nil ->
358+
updated_track_data = put_in(state.track_data, [track_id, :codec], codec)
351359
state = %{state | track_data: updated_track_data}
352-
:ok = File.write!(state.manifest_path, state.track_data |> to_manifest |> ExWebRTC.Recorder.Manifest.to_map() |> Jason.encode!())
360+
361+
:ok =
362+
File.write!(
363+
state.manifest_path,
364+
state.track_data
365+
|> to_manifest
366+
|> ExWebRTC.Recorder.Manifest.to_map()
367+
|> Jason.encode!()
368+
)
369+
353370
Logger.info("Updated manifest with codec info for track #{track_id}")
354371
state
355372

0 commit comments

Comments
 (0)